Renovation of a municipal facility in Bangor, Maine. Completed plans call for the renovation of a municipal facility.
The awarded Bidder will be responsible for completing an in-depth examination ofthe space to be renovated, and based on said examination, provide a proposal designed properly for the size and intended use. The bidder's proposed scope ofwork should include all necessary equipment, material, permits I licenses, and manpower to perform the required tasks. This project does not include dealing with any hazardous materials. If any such materials are found, the removal and disposal of any hazardous/universai waste will be performed by others. RFP District Attorneys Office Renovation Penobscot County Commissioners are requesting proposals from qualified firms to provide all labor, tools, and equipment to safely renovate the spaces on the 2nd floor of the old Penobscot County Courthouse, which has been used as the County Commissioner's Courtroom into functional office spaces for the District Attorneys office. All questions must be submitted, via email, to bmacdonald@penobscot-county.net by the end of business on Wednesday, August 13, 2025. Any technical questions concerning the RFP, equipment specific questions, or documentation shall to be addressed to: Brian MacDonald, Facilities Director 97 Hammond St. Bangor, Maine 04401 (207) 469-9954 * Email: bmacdonald@penobscot-county.net A summary of all questions and answers will become the final amendment to the RFP, and will be shared with all interested bidders via email, if supplied, and posted on the County website no later than noon Friday, August 15, 2025. The County, at its sole discretion, reserves the right to reject any or all bids, wholly or in part, and to waive minor informalities and irregularities found in proposals received in response to the RFP.
